I am designing the patch antenna by using ADS 2006.
Operation frequency = 3.5Ghz
substrate is FR4
fo 3.5GHz
ε r 4.5
ε eff 4.0935
W 25.84mm
L 19.78mm
thickness of substrate h 1.6mm
thickness of copper t 0.035mm
But the simulation result for s parameter show that resonant frequency is at 7.5Ghz(lowest loss return)
What should I do next? change the dimension of patch antenna? or the feed line ?
What is the most suitable value for the mesh density (cell per wavelength) ?
